‘Ayn Abū Su‘ayfān
‘Ayn Abū Su‘ayfān is a spring in West Bank, Palestine. ‘Ayn Abū Su‘ayfān is situated nearby to the locality Ash Shaykh ‘Arūrī, as well as near the suburb Beitillu.Places of Interest

Khirbet Tibnah
Archaeological site
Photo: Amos1947,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Khirbet Tibnah is a tell located in the Ramallah and al-Bireh Governorate of the West Bank, between the villages Deir Nidham and Nabi Salih. It was inhabited from the Early Bronze Age to the Ottoman period. Khirbet Tibnah is situated 3 km northwest of ‘Ayn Abū Su‘ayfān.
Jibiya
Residential area
Jibiya is a Palestinian village in the Ramallah and al-Bireh Governorate. It was founded after the 16th century. It is mentioned in text from 1697. Jibiya is situated 4 km northeast of ‘Ayn Abū Su‘ayfān.

Beitillu
Suburb
Photo: יעקב,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Beitillu is a Palestinian town located in the Ramallah and al-Bireh Governorate in the northern West Bank, 19 kilometers Northwest of Ramallah. According to the Palestinian Central Bureau of Statistics, it had a population of 3,465 in 2017.
Nahliel
Village
Photo: Dnd man,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Nahliel is a Haredi Israeli settlement in the West Bank. Located close to the Palestinian villages of Beitillu and Deir 'Ammar, and some 20 kilometres from Modi'in, it is organised as a community settlement and falls under the jurisdiction of the Mateh Binyamin Regional Council.
Deir Nidham
Village
Photo: יעקב,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Deir Nidham is a Palestinian village in the Ramallah and al-Bireh Governorate in the central West Bank. It is located approximately 23 kilometers northwest of the city of Ramallah and its elevation is 590 meters.
